PyRIT is like a security _framework_ - it provides building blocks but requires expertise to implement. ::: ## Different Tools for Different Teams **Promptfoo** is a red teaming toolkit designed for engineering teams building AI applications. It dynamically generates application-specific attacks using specialized models, testing for vulnerabilities like prompt injections, data leaks, and unauthorized tool usage. The tool integrates directly into CI/CD pipelines and provides actionable security reports. **PyRIT (Python Risk Identification Toolkit)** is a Python framework from Microsoft's AI Red Team that provides building blocks for creating custom red teaming scenarios. It enables security researchers to orchestrate AI-vs-AI attacks, where an attacker agent attempts to exploit a target system while a judge evaluates the results. ## Attack Generation: Automated vs. Customizable The tools take fundamentally different approaches to generating attacks: ### Promptfoo: Context-Aware Automation - Generates thousands of application-specific attacks automatically - Adapts prompts based on your app's purpose (e.g., "banking chatbot" gets finance-specific attacks) - No generic prompts - every attack is tailored to your use case - Uses specialized uncensored models for attack generation ### PyRIT: Flexible Framework - Provides attack converters (Base64, ASCII art, persuasion techniques) - Requires manual goal definition (e.g., tester comes up with "extract account transaction history" and similar test cases) - Requires Python scripting ## Technical Security Coverage Both tools address core LLM security risks, but with different areas of focus: ### RAG and Data Security Promptfoo's Built-in RAG Tests: - Direct and indirect prompt injections - Unauthorized data retrieval - RBAC (Role-Based Access Control) violations - Context poisoning attacks - Automatic testing via web UI PyRIT's RAG Capabilities: - Direct and indirect prompt injections - Ability to set up tests for RBAC violations and data retrieval using custom Python implementation ### Agent and Tool Misuse Promptfoo provides pre-built tests for: - Unauthorized tool execution - Privilege escalation attempts - API misuse (BOLA, BFLA) - Server-Side Request Forgery (SSRF) PyRIT includes: - Multi-turn attacks developed by Microsoft - The ability to construct custom tool abuse scenarios in Python ## Integration and Workflow ### Promptfoo: Built for DevSecOps ```bash # Setup in minutes npx promptfoo@latest redteam setup # Run in CI/CD promptfoo redteam run # View results promptfoo redteam report ``` **Features:** - Direct CI/CD integration with pass/fail - Visual reports with severity ratings - Maps findings to OWASP Top 10 and other frameworks for LLMs - Tests APIs, endpoints, or browser interfaces - Optional customization via Python or Javascript scripting ### PyRIT: Built for Flexibility PyRIT requires Python scripting. ```python # Requires custom implementation from pyrit import Orchestrator, AttackerAgent orchestrator = Orchestrator() attacker = AttackerAgent(goal="Extract user data") results = orchestrator.run(attacker, target) ``` **Features:** - Extensible through Python classes - Integrates with Python workflows - Best for one-off assessments - Requires result interpretation ## Community and Ecosystem ### Promptfoo - 200,000+ users since 2023 - Used by 44 Fortune 500 companies - Featured in OpenAI, Anthropic, AWS course materials - Regular updates for new attack techniques - Active Discord and GitHub community ### PyRIT - Created by Microsoft AI Red Team - Used in Microsoft red team engagements - Pure open-source - Relies on off-the-shelf models - Regular updates for new attack techniques :::info Promptfoo offers ISO 27001 compliance and enterprise support.
